Stanley Black & Decker and Discovery Education Announce 2020 Making for Good Challenge Winners

Stanley Black & Decker and Discovery Education announce the winners of the 2020 Making for Good Challenge. Working in teams of 2-4, high school students nationwide created 60-90 second videos outlining innovative solutions to societal or environmental needs. The annual challenge builds upon a Stanley Black & Decker and Discovery Education educational program – Innovation Generation – igniting, engaging, and empowering students to become makers through no-cost dynamic digital resources. George at Asda announce the launch of the UK’s first supermarket sustainably sourced school uniform

Leading supermarket fashion retailer George at Asda has announced that it’s launching a sustainably sourced school uniform as part of its George for Good commitment, offering customers the chance to buy recycled or sustainably sourced school clothing from one of the top four supermarkets for the first time. The majority of the range will be responsibly sourced via the Better Cotton Initiative (BCI). Country Time Launches Littlest Bailout Relief Fund for Kids’ Lemonade Stands

It’s summer and that means lemonade season, but this summer things are looking a bit dry. Lemonade stands across the country are closed due to social distancing guidelines, which are hindering the typical foot traffic neighborhood stands receive. With the economic repercussions of COVID-19, the big guys are muscling the little guys out of the way and pushing for bailout funds meant for small businesses. A Poor Ugandan Community Turns on the Swagger to Attract Investment by DUDE

Independent creative agency DUDE:London, have created a charity campaign with a difference: a hip hop music video. NGO Communities for Development – who empower people and communities to build a better future for themselves – commissioned DUDE to create a campaign for Bulambuli, a rural Ugandan community in desperate need of investment.  Competition for public donations is fierce.
